First Trust Advisors LP trimmed its holdings in shares of SiriusPoint Ltd. (NYSE:SPNT - Free Report) by 20.4% in the fourth quarter, according to its most recent Form 13F filing with the SEC. The institutional investor owned 313,504 shares of the company's stock after selling 80,255 shares during the period. First Trust Advisors LP owned about 0.19% of SiriusPoint worth $5,138,000 as of its most recent SEC filing.

SiriusPoint (NYSE:SPNT - Get Free Report) last released its earnings results on Monday, May 5th. The company reported $0.49 EPS for the quarter, topping analysts' consensus estimates of $0.26 by $0.23. SiriusPoint had a return on equity of 8.73% and a net margin of 7.68%. The company had revenue of $727.30 million for the quarter, compared to the consensus estimate of $688.00 million.
Insider Activity
In other news, Director Daniel S. Loeb sold 4,106,631 shares of SiriusPoint stock in a transaction dated Thursday, February 27th. The stock was sold at an average price of $13.71, for a total transaction of $56,301,911.01. Following the sale, the director now directly owns 9,428,008 shares of the company's stock, valued at approximately $129,257,989.68. This trade represents a 30.34 % decrease in their ownership of the stock. The sale was disclosed in a document filed with the SEC, which can be accessed through the SEC website. 11.70% of the stock is currently owned by corporate insiders.

SiriusPoint Ltd. provides multi-line insurance and reinsurance products and services worldwide. The company operates through two segments, Reinsurance, and Insurance & Services. The Reinsurance segment provides aviation and space, accident and health, casualty, credit, marine and energy, property to insurance and reinsurance companies, government entities, and other risk bearing vehicles.
